Table 3.
Comparison between the levels of concern about Covid-19 and personal characteristics of healthcare workers in Saudi Arabia
Characteristics | Low concern (score = 0–39) | Moderate concern (score = 40–55) | High concern (score = 56–96) | Mean concern score |
---|---|---|---|---|
Total | 213 (25.2) | 396 (46.9) | 235 (27.9) | 48.5 ± 12.8 |
Gender | ||||
Male | 83 (25.5) | 160 (49.1) | 83 (25.5) | 47.3 ± 12.2 |
Female | 130 (25.1) | 236 (45.6) | 152 (29.3) | 49.2 ± 13.1 |
χ2 = 1.62, df = 2, p = 0.44 | t = 2.14, p = 0.33 | |||
Age (years) | ||||
≤ 30 | 19 (17.9) | 47 (44.3) | 40 (37.7) | 50.4 ± 13.1 |
30–45 | 117 (23.5) | 231 (46.4) | 150 (30.1) | 49.7 ± 13.1 |
> 45 | 77 (32.1) | 118 (49.2) | 45 (18.8) | 45.2 ± 11.3 |
χ2 = 19.52, ==0.001* | f = 11.60, p < 0.001* | |||
Marital status | ||||
Unmarried | 61 (21.6) | 129 (45.6) | 93 (32.9) | 49.5 ± 12.9 |
Married | 152 (27.1) | 267 (47.6) | 142 (25.3) | 48.0 ± 12.7 |
χ2 = 6.30, df = 2, p = 0.043* | t = 1.58, p = 0.11 | |||
Nationality | ||||
Saudi | 72 (21.2) | 146 (42.9) | 122 (35.9) | 51.1 ± 13.7 |
Non-Saudi | 141 (28.0) | 250 (49.6) | 113 (22.4) | 46.7 ± 11.8 |
χ2 = 18.86, df = 2, p < 0.001* | t = 4.81, p < 0.001* | |||
Level of education | ||||
Diploma | 38 (29.9) | 54 (42.5) | 35 (27.6) | 48.0 ± 14.3 |
BS | 107 (21.1) | 246 (48.5) | 154 (30.4) | 49.6 ± 12.4 |
MSN/PHD | 68 (32.4) | 96 (45.7) | 46 (21.9) | 46.0 ± 12.4 |
χ2 = 13.48, df = 4, p = 0.009* | f = 6.26, p = 0.002* | |||
Job title | ||||
Physician/Dentist/Pharmacist | 59 (26.7) | 105 (47.5) | 57 (25.8) | 46.9 ± 10.9 |
Nurse | 75 (22.1) | 168 (49.4) | 97 (28.5) | 49.4 ± 12.3 |
Technician | 35 (33.0) | 46 (43.4) | 25 (23.6) | 46.7 ± 12.6 |
Administrative | 44 (24.9) | 77 (43.5) | 56 (31.6) | 49.9 ± 15.5 |
χ2 = 14.54, df = 6, p < 0.001* | f = 3.18, p = 0.023* | |||
Geographical region of employment | ||||
Central | 124 (28.4) | 192 (44.0) | 120 (27.5) | 47.9 ± 13.5 |
Eastern | 50 (27.3) | 88 (48.1) | 45 (24.6) | 47.8 ± 12.6 |
Western | 39 (17.3) | 116 (51.6) | 70 (31.1) | 50.1 ± 11.2 |
χ2 = 11.09, df = 4, p = 0.026* | f = 2.2.58, p = 0.076 | |||
Direct patient contact | ||||
Yes | 120 (24.0) | 224 (44.8) | 156 (31.2) | 49.1 ± 12.5 |
No | 93 (27.0) | 172 (50.0) | 79 (23.0) | 47.7 ± 13.2 |
χ2 = 6.88, df = 2, p = 0.032* | t = 1.58, p = 0.11 | |||
Positive family member | ||||
yes | 11 (25.0) | 21 (47.7) | 12 (27.3) | 49.4 ± 12.6 |
No/Don’t know | 202 (25.3) | 375 (46.9) | 223 (27.9) | 48.4 ± 12.8 |
χ2 = 0.013, df = 2, p = 0.99 | t = 0.48, p = 0.63 | |||
Living condition | ||||
Alone | 59 (36.4) | 70 (43.2) | 33 (20.4) | 45.1 ± 12.8 |
With others | 154 (22.6) | 326 (47.8) | 202 (29.6) | 49.3 ± 12.7 |
χ2 = 14.54, df = 2, p = 0.001* | t = 3.84, p < 0.001* |
χ2 Pearson Chi squared test, f Analysis of variance (ANOVA) test, *--Statistically significant difference, df degree of freedom
